Output 32e8923d258052443715516d7cc67df2380db72816acf8946934660345825606:0

value
13698928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ea5030797c7d7d165ce6ada9035c788a2b3ee78a OP_EQUAL
address
3P3x75wiUUWw92sHr7TQwJps7nqiRHdA48
transaction
32e8923d258052443715516d7cc67df2380db72816acf8946934660345825606
spent
true